Okay, after much googling (and years of no answers whenever I brought it up to dermatologists) I am diagnosing myself with Solar Urticaria. Unlike the commoner Polymorphous Light Eruption (PLE), SU can be triggered by non-UV wavelengths (including through clothing, like yesterday when I was wearing sun-protective UPF pants, per image) and appears minutes, not hours, after exposure. Also my skin eruptions look just like the pictures.
en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Solar_ur…

Apparently management includes my favorite antihistamine for sleeping, good ol' Benadryl! I've been avoiding it due to fear of senility, but one makes trade-offs in life, and since I suffer both sun allergy and chronic insomnia, I'm gonna take it every night for a while. Yay! A little further "research" indicates elevated histamine levels can cause insomnia. Elevated histamine is associated with autoimmune disease, which I have up the wazoo. Benadryl, here I come!!!

Will a Mobile Stone Crusher Cost More?


When considering the purchase of a stone crusher for your construction or mining project, one of the primary concerns is cost. Crushers, whether stationary or mobile, are substantial investments that play a vital role in your operations. However, the question arises: will a mobile stone crusher cost more than its stationary counterpart? In this article, we will explore the factors influencing the cost of mobile stone crushers and how they compare to other types of crushers, such as limestone crushers and industrial stone crushers.

Understanding the Basics of Mobile Stone Crushers


Mobile stone crushers are designed for flexibility and mobility, allowing them to be transported easily from one site to another. Unlike stationary crushers, which are fixed in one location, mobile crushers are equipped with wheels or tracks, making them highly versatile for various projects. They are especially useful in situations where access to a single location is limited or when the crusher(trituradora de piedra) needs to be moved frequently between different work areas.

These crushers are typically used for crushing a variety of materials, such as limestone, granite, and other rocks. They are commonly used in mining, aggregate production, and recycling operations, where mobility is crucial for efficiency.

Factors That Affect the Cost of Mobile Stone Crushers


The cost of a mobile stone crusher can be influenced by several factors, including its design, features, and capabilities. While mobile stone crushers tend to be more expensive than stationary models, several factors come into play when determining the overall price.

1. Mobility and Convenience


The most significant advantage of a mobile stone crusher is its mobility. Being able to move the crusher from one location to another without requiring disassembly or transportation by truck adds significant value. However, this mobility comes with a price. The advanced engineering required for mobility, such as tracks or wheels, additional components for transportation, and reinforced structures, can make mobile crushers more expensive than stationary ones.

For industries that need to move equipment across various work sites, the added cost of a mobile crusher may be justified by the operational flexibility it provides. This is particularly true for projects involving multiple locations or tight access areas where a stationary crusher would not be feasible.

2. Technology and Features


Mobile stone crushers often come equipped with advanced features and technologies that enhance their efficiency, performance, and ease of use. These features may include:


  • Automated control systems: Mobile crushers are often integrated with computerized systems that allow for real-time monitoring and adjustment of the machine's performance, optimizing production and reducing downtime.
  • Fuel efficiency: Modern mobile crushers are designed with fuel-efficient engines to reduce operational costs, but these advanced systems increase the initial price.
  • Enhanced mobility: The design of mobile crushers, which includes tracks or wheels and robust suspension systems, often comes with higher manufacturing costs.
  • Dust suppression systems: Dust is a significant concern in crushing operations, and mobile crushers often come with built-in dust control systems that add to the overall cost.

While these advanced technologies add to the price of the mobile stone crusher, they can also increase the machine's productivity, reduce environmental impact, and improve operator safety.

3. Crusher Capacity and Power


The cost of a mobile stone crusher can also vary depending on its capacity and power. Larger models designed to handle high-output production and tougher materials, such as an industrial stone crusher(trituradora de piedra industrial) or a limestone crusher, will cost more due to the size of the machine and the power required for its operation.

Mobile crushers with higher capacities may be more expensive upfront, but they can offer greater efficiency and higher production rates, making them a valuable long-term investment for large-scale operations. Smaller mobile crushers, which are suitable for lighter applications, will generally cost less but may not be as efficient for heavy-duty tasks.

4. Customization and Configuration


Mobile stone crushers are often available in various configurations, depending on the needs of the operation. Some models are designed for specific materials, such as limestone crushers(molino para piedra caliza) or crushers that specialize in aggregate production. Customized configurations may include different crusher types (e.g., jaw crushers, cone crushers, or impact crushers), which can increase the overall cost of the machine.

For example, a mobile stone crusher designed to handle particularly abrasive or tough materials, like limestone, may require additional reinforcement or specialized features, making it more expensive than a standard model.

5. Maintenance and Operating Costs


In addition to the initial cost, maintenance and operating costs play a significant role in the overall cost of owning a mobile stone crusher. Mobile crushers often have more moving parts than stationary crushers, which can increase the likelihood of wear and tear. Regular maintenance, including replacing parts such as tracks, wheels, or engines, is essential to keep the machine running efficiently.

However, because mobile stone crushers can often be moved to the work site, there is less need for additional machinery, transportation, or setup time, which can help offset the higher maintenance costs.

Comparing Mobile Stone Crushers to Other Crusher Types

1. Stationary Crushers


In comparison to mobile crushers, stationary crushers are generally less expensive, as they do not require the advanced mobility features and components that mobile units have. A stationary stone crusher may be more cost-effective for operations that focus on a single, permanent location, where mobility is not as important. However, they lack the flexibility to be moved between different job sites.

2. Limestone Crushers


Limestone crushers are designed specifically for crushing limestone, which is a softer material compared to other rocks. These crushers are usually available in both stationary and mobile models. A mobile limestone crusher may be more expensive than a stationary model due to the added features for portability, but it offers the flexibility to operate in multiple locations and handle various materials.

3. Industrial Stone Crushers


Industrial stone crushers are heavy-duty machines designed for large-scale operations. These crushers are typically stationary and can handle a wide range of materials, from rocks to aggregates. While they may not offer the same level of mobility as a mobile stone crusher, they are often more affordable upfront, making them a suitable choice for large-scale, long-term projects.

Conclusion: Is a Mobile Stone Crusher Worth the Extra Cost?


The decision to invest in a mobile stone crusher largely depends on the specific needs of your operation. While mobile crushers tend to be more expensive than stationary models due to their mobility, advanced technology, and capacity features, they offer significant advantages in terms of flexibility, efficiency, and convenience. For operations that require frequent relocation, tight access, or versatility in handling different materials, a mobile stone crusher may justify the higher upfront cost.

On the other hand, if your operation is based in a single location with minimal need for mobility, a stationary crusher may provide a more cost-effective solution. Ultimately, the choice between a mobile stone crusher and other types of crushers, such as limestone crushers or industrial stone crushers, should be based on your specific operational requirements, project size, and budget.
